Here’s what Above Average say about their Monochrome Black Jockstrap.
Our classic Monochrome Jock has a super-soft Pouch made from 95% Cotton and 5% Spandex allowing it stretch and ensuring a comfortable fit.
Our wide 6cm Waistband is designed to hug you around the Waist and prevent folding or twisting so you always look your best.
The signature Branded Label along the back along with contrasting Straps will frame your Bum perfectly.
It’s material.
I absolutely loved it’s material, as even though it was made from 95% Cotton and 5% Spandex, I thought that it felt incredibly soft against my Skin, and was more like it was made out of an incredibly silky soft and stretchy yet ever so slightly fluffy Cotton, Spandex and Polyamide blend rather than a thick and fluffy yet ever so slightly stretchy Cotton and Spandex blend..
Its size.
I really liked it’s size, as even though I have quite a wide sized Waist, I found that Extra Large fitted me like a Glove and didn’t move around or dig into my Skin whilst I was wearing it.
It’s support.
I absolutely loved how well this supported me, as it’s Pouch cupped and lifted my Balls and kept them in one place so that they didn’t move around or mean that I had to keep readjusting my Underwear. I also really liked that because of it’s wide Waistband and it’s really thin Leg Straps , that it felt really comfy to wear and also managed to make me look a little bit bigger than I actually am too.
It’s packaging.
I really liked its packaging, as this came in a short rectangular Padded Envelope that kept it really fresh until I was ready to start wearing it.
My overall thoughts.
Overall I would have to rate the Above Average Monochrome Black Jockstrap a nine out of ten. I absolutely loved it’s incredibly silky soft and stretchy yet ever so slightly fluffy material, it’s size, it’s support, and it’s packaging, but I just wish that it was available in some other colours, like Navy, Red, or maybe even Yellow.
